Cost to hire movers from Cleveland to Connecticut

If you’re moving a studio or one-bedroom home from Cleveland to Connecticut, you can expect to spend between $1,128 and $3,232. For a two- or three-bedroom place, prices usually range from $2,191 to $5,304 on the same route. Got a larger household? Moving a four- or five-bedroom home typically runs between $3,847 and $8,180.

Cost of moving containers from Cleveland to Connecticut

When moving from Cleveland to Connecticut, for a small load, you’ll likely pay between $645 and $1,652. If you have a two- or three-bedroom home, costs usually range from $1,202 to $2,445. Got a big family or a four-plus bedroom house? Expect prices ranging anywhere from $1,682 up to $2,876. For detailed pricing info, take a look at our complete PODS cost guide.

Check out the most affordable moving container companies to help with your move from Cleveland.

Cost of moving truck rentals from Cleveland to Connecticut

Looking to save money? Renting a moving truck is usually your cheapest option. Just keep in mind that you’ll handle all the lifting, packing, and driving yourself.

If you’re moving out of a studio or one-bedroom in Cleveland to relocate to Connecticut and are renting a truck, plan to spend between $417 and $815. For two- or three-bedroom moves, prices typically land between $446 and $957. Dealing with a four-bedroom-plus home? Expect rental truck costs to be somewhere between $550 and $1,108.

These cost ranges already include estimated fuel costs.

What you should know before moving from Cleveland to CT

Heading from Cleveland to Connecticut comes with new adventures, but also a bump in living expenses. Because Connecticut usually has a higher cost of living than Cleveland, it’s smart to budget and plan ahead.

Discover how life in Cleveland compares with Connecticut to help you make an informed moving decision:

Compare cost of living: Cleveland vs. Connecticut

Cleveland, OH Connecticut
Average rent $1,295 $1,374
Average home cost $108,509 $405,595
Average income (per capita) $64,965 $90,213
Cost of living index 83 100
Unemployment rate 6.8% 3.0%
State income tax 3.5% 3.0%
  • Rent is about 6% more expensive in Connecticut than in Cleveland, so be sure to factor this increase into your budget.
  • Home prices in Connecticut are about 274% higher than in Cleveland, so budget for a higher mortgage bill.
  • In Connecticut, average earnings are about 39% higher than in Cleveland, giving you some extra financial breathing room.
  • Living in Connecticut will cost about 20% more than in Cleveland, so it’s important to budget for the increase.
  • With unemployment about 56% lower in Connecticut than in Cleveland, you may find it easier to secure work.
  • Moving to Connecticut means income taxes about 14% lower than in Ohio, so you’ll enjoy extra take-home pay.

How life is different in Cleveland, OH from Connecticut

If you’re considering a move from Cleveland to Connecticut, there are some notable lifestyle differences to keep in mind. From climate and population size to political leanings, here’s how life in Connecticut compares to life in Cleveland.

Cleveland, OH Connecticut
Population 372,624 3,617,176
Political leaning Republican 55-43 Democratic 56-44
Summer high 82ºF 83ºF
Winter low 22ºF 18ºF
Annual rain 38″ 50″
Annual snow 54″ 37″
Crime index 63.41 16.44
  • In the last presidential election, Connecticut leaned Democratic, while Cleveland supported Republican.
  • Summer highs generally reach around 83ºF in both Connecticut and Cleveland, meaning the climate will feel quite familiar. Don’t forget to factor in humidity, prevailing weather patterns, and energy costs to gain a full picture of what summer life will be like in your new location.
  • Winter lows in Connecticut and Cleveland are close — 18ºF vs 22ºF. With little difference, you’ll likely notice only minimal changes to your day-to-day life in winter.
  • Expect 50 inches of rain each year in Connecticut, compared with just 38 inches in Cleveland. That’s more frequent rainfall, so be ready for lush landscapes and the occasional soggy day.
  • In Connecticut, you’ll see just 37 inches of snow each year, compared to Cleveland, which gets 54 inches annually. Moving to Connecticut means enjoying gentler winters, less shoveling, and fewer weather headaches.
  • Crime is lower in Connecticut, with an index of 16.44 compared to Cleveland at 63.41. This generally points to safer neighborhoods and a stronger sense of security.

Other considerations when moving to Connecticut

When relocating from Cleveland to Connecticut, a few details are worth keeping in mind to avoid last-minute hiccups. Beyond choosing a mover and packing your belongings, it’s helpful to consider local rules, permit requirements, and other practical factors that could impact your move.

  • HOA rules: Make sure to check your neighborhood or community’s moving rules ahead of time to avoid any surprises on moving day.
  • Elevator reservation: Reserve your building’s elevator ahead of time if one is available for moving day.
  • Truck parking permits: Some cities ask for parking permits when you’re using a moving truck or large vehicle. Check in advance to see if you’ll need a permit for your move.
  • State licensing: The Connecticut Department of Transportation (CDOT) regulates in-state moving companies and taxi, trucking, and bus companies. In addition, customers are also protected from scam movers by regulations set forth by the Connecticut State Department of Consumer Protection. Make sure your moving company has all the proper licenses before you book with them.
  • State regulator: You can verify a Connecticut moving license and its status on the state regulator’s official website.
  • Moving permits: You won’t need a moving permit for Connecticut, but it’s smart to look into local parking rules before your move.
  • Change of address: Make sure to submit your USPS change of address form at least a week before you move. You’ll be able to choose your official move date so your mail is forwarded to Connecticut seamlessly. Get started here.
  • Moving insurance: Insurance requirements vary by state, so be sure to review the regulations where you live. Opting for Released Value Protection is a budget-friendly choice, as it comes at no extra cost from movers, although it provides minimal coverage. Under this option, the mover’s liability is limited to a maximum of 60 cents per pound per article. If your belongings are valuable and you seek coverage beyond this limited protection, it’s recommended to discuss alternative options with your chosen moving company or explore third-party insurance providers.

FAQ

How long does a move from Cleveland to Connecticut take?

How long will your move from Cleveland, OH to Connecticut take? It depends on the type of service you pick, but you can usually expect it to take one to six days. Just keep in mind that moves during the busy summer season may take a bit longer.

To get your move done as quickly as possible, ask for a delivery timeframe before you book your moving company.

What’s the availability of custom crating among movers in Cleveland?

We track 13 movers in Cleveland that can build custom crates for items such as art, antiques, and sensitive electronics. Be sure to confirm with a Cleveland moving company that the materials and dimensions match your item requirements.

Can I use cash to pay a mover in Cleveland, OH?

Currently, three movers in Cleveland accept cash as a payment option. Still, cash isn’t widely used in the moving industry, which favors traceable methods and clear receipts. Expect to pay a deposit first to secure your move date. The rest is due either at pickup or once delivery is complete—check with your mover on the exact payment schedule and accepted types.
